Excerpt from Business-a ProfessionIt is true that at the present time the lawyer does not hold that position With the people which he held fifty years ago, but the reason is in my opinion not lack of opportunity. It is because, instead of holding a position of independence between the wealthy and the people, prepared to curb the excesses of either, the able lawyers have to a great extent allowed them selves to become an adjunct of the great corporations, and have neglected their obligation to use their powers for the protection of the people. If we are to solve the important economic, social and industrial ques tions Which have become political questions also, it seems to me clear that the attitude of the lawyer in this respect must be materially changed.
